RCB crosses CSK and MI in Franchise Valuation Race

The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B) franchise is currently involved in a controversy after a horrific stampede after winning its title outside the M Chinnaswamy Stadium.
After years of heartbreak on the field, Royal Challengers Bengaluru (RCB) finally lifted their maiden IPL trophy in 2025, and now, they’ve followed it up with a win off the field. In a landmark in the IPL’s financial landscape, RCB have overtaken long-time rivals Chennai Super Kings (CSK) to become the league’s most valuable franchise, ending CSK’s reign at the top of the valuation charts.
Most Valued IPL Teams 2025
Rank | Franchise | Brand Value (USD) | Brand Value (INR) |
---|---|---|---|
1 | Royal Challengers Bengaluru (RCB) | $269 million | ₹2,242 crore |
2 | Mumbai Indians (MI) | $242 million | ₹2,016 crore |
3 | Chennai Super Kings (CSK) | $235 million | ₹1,958 crore |
4 |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R) | $205 million | ₹1,708 crore |
5 | Rajasthan Royals (RR) | $162 million | ₹1,351 crore |
6 | Punjab Kings (PBKS) | $141 million | ₹1,175 crore |
7 | Lucknow Super Giants (LSG) | $125 million | ₹1,043 crore |
8 | Delhi Capitals (DC) | $118 million | ₹985 crore |
9 | Gujarat Titans (GT) | $107 million | ₹892 crore |
10 | Sunrisers Hyderabad (SRH) | $97 million | ₹809 crore |
